When a handful of people meet at Dacula onNovember 6th 2011, hardly did they know that their endeavour would thrive. Having reluctantly departed from others who strangely wondered why, this group of Christian set their face like a flint and decided there was no looking back. After all our Lord said he who takes the plough and looks back is not fit for the Kingdom.

Five years on that young Fellowship is a power called CHRIST THE KING GHANA METHODIST CHURCH. This young Society has seen it all and with God's power survived. The impact is massive and ears keep tingling with each news. Its ripples beginning from Dacula and to Winder will go beyond the State, the Lord has promised, after all the vision from the Lord from the onset was "A Light to the Nations".

This Society is to say the least a Church-Family, where sharing and bearing each others' burden  are common place. Fellowship and love are blended into a garment for all. Times of hardship and disagreement reared their ugly heads but faith and love plunged them down the dust. 

As we celebrate  King Jesus and His victories through mortals for the last 5 years we aim at telling all who will listen that this Society has come to stay.
